Allegro uses Solr as our main search engine. Due to their search engine traffic and index size, they needed to develop custom optimizations. In offer listings, they were supposed to group together offers representing different variants of the same product so that they would be displayed as a single item. Allegro started with configuring built in solr collapsing query parser, but it was not competitive enough so they developed a custom filter and compared its implementations with sorted indexes and priority queue. After a few months they needed to choose the best offer in a group by one sort expression, then finally re-sort the results by the second sort expression. They tried a few approaches, starting with our custom collapser with a defined size priority queue, then grouping a long type field. Finally, we changed built-in Solr collapser plugin, which in their case allowed to decrease query time by 40%. Our improvement was merged into Solr 8.1.
